Lavender carries Ohio State past Penn State

Feb 29, 2008 - 2:54 AM STATE COLLEGE, Pennsylvania (Ticker) -- Jantal Lavender scored a career-high 36 points and had 16 rebounds to lead No. 22 Ohio State to an 87-84 victory over Penn State in Big Ten action on Thursday.

Marscilla Packer added 18 points for the Buckeyes (21-7, 12-5 Big Ten), who can clinch the regular-season conference title with a win over last-place Northwestern on Sunday.

Ohio State held a three-point lead at the break and the score was tied at 73-73 with just over seven minutes to play. But the Buckeyes used an 8-2 burst - four points coming from Lavender - to take an 81-75 lead with 4:09 remaining.

The Nittany Lions (13-16, 4-13) fought back and cut the deficit to three on a layup by Mashea Williams with 45 seconds to play. Penn State had a chance to tie the game late, but Kamela Gissendanner's 3-pointer was off the mark.

Gissendanner finished with 25 points and Janessa Wolff added 16 and 10 rebounds to lead Penn State, which has lost 10 consecutive games.
